1. you can use your own box
2. see if you can find rates for UPS ground, for Fedex home delivery, you can estimate rates by inputing box dimensions, weights, destinations.
3. The shipping weights depends on two things, one is your zone, how far you are sending those boxes; second, weights-- the actual weights or dimensional weights-- which ever is higher. To calculate dimensional weights, multiply length,height and width, then scale one number-- I do not remember.
